Cannabis joint held aloft in French parliament

Francois-Michel Lambert on Tuesday (May 4) said legalization would make it possible to fight trafficking, create tax revenues and jobs, before brandishing a cup with a cannabis leaf on it and then pulling what appeared to be an unlit joint from it.

Richard Ferrand, president of the National Assembly, interjected and said Lambert could face a penalty fo doing so.

The stunt came one day before a multi-party parliamentary report was released advocating for marijuana legalization.
